India win but Kohli fumes over ‘soft signal’ calls – cricket.com.au
Two contentious outfield catches that were given out due to the ‘soft signal’ from the on-field umpire have left Virat Kohli less than impressed after his side…
India battled through final-over drama to beat England by eight runs in the fourth Twenty20 International and level the five-match series 2-2 in Ahmedabad.
But the match threatened to be overshadowed by two contentious calls in India’s innings, both of which went against the home side.
India skipper Virat Kohli used his post-match interview to complain about the umpiring protocols which saw Suryakumar Yadav and Washington Sundar given out caught despite inconclusive replays.
